Mintage & Variants

Date Mintage Comment Frequency
1917  F#488.4, Ø 23.4 or 23.9 mm
1917  F#488.4a) Ø 23.4 mm, central hole 2.0 mm, planchet is 1.1 mm thick, on both sides a small iron cross below in the pearl circle. Obv: Kreis is 9.2 mm wide. Rev: Pfennig is 16.3 mm wide.
1917  F#488.4b) Ø 23.9 mm, central hole 1.8 mm, planchet is 1.2 mm thick. Obv: Kreis is 10.8 mm wide. Rev: Pfennig is 16.8 mm wide.
1917  100 F#488.4c) Ø 24.0 mm, central hole 1.6 mm, planchet is 1.5 mm thick, on both sides a small iron cross below in the pearl circle. Obv: Kreis is 9.5 mm wide. Rev: Pfennig is 16.0 mm wide. Röttinger-Nachprägung
